The software, an extension of Civil3D, allows for the design of photovoltaic systems by significantly reducing the time as it provides the ability to define the layout on predefined areas by simply configuring the type of structure (tracker or fixed), the pitch, and importing the survey through the program itself or from external data. It is also possible to perform a civil analysis with the aim of calculating the necessary excavations and backfills for the positioning of the structures. Among other functions, the electrical configuration is very useful, allowing for the wiring of strings and the rapid export of the single-line diagram. A positive aspect of the software is certainly the always available technical support and the academy with constantly updated video courses. I use it daily on all projects and recommend its purchase to those dealing with issues related to drafting a plant layout, especially in the initial phase when one often has to modify the configuration of the structures to find the optimal one. In my company, we work on different phases of the development of a PV plant until its commissioning, and it is useful in all of them:
-In the search for suitable land for PV plants, it helps us design plants much faster than without this tool, allowing us to optimize the work and test many fields at once.
-In the US department, it allows us to:
.Convert structures (fixed type or tracker) layout not done in pvcase to pvcase easily
.Take cable measurements minimizing errors and significantly reducing execution time. These also include 3D tracing, making them more accurate
.Agile string numbering
.Generation of basic single-line diagrams very quickly
.Positioning of piles, with the possibility of exporting to an Excel document included
.Earth movements
.Etc.

If there is one issue I have had with PVcase ground mount, it has to be units/scaling. I am a seasoned AutoCAD 2D user, and find myself consistently messing up units on PVcase so my modules are shown extremely small. It would be useful if there was a warning before producing a layout when the module is extremely small relative to your working area. Review collected by and hosted on G2.com.
